The difference between "git commit" and "git push"

git commit is "recording the changes to the repository" Change" is to submit locally modified files to the local library; and git push is to "update remote references and related objects", which is to send the latest information in the local library to the remote library.

Therefore, git commit is used to connect to the local repository and operates the local library; and git push is used to interact with the remote repository and operates the remote library.

<span style="font-size: 18px;"> <strong>Git commit</strong></span>

git commit Mainly commits the changes in the temporary storage area to the local repository. Every time we use the git commit command, we will generate a 40-digit hash value in the local repository. This hash value is also called commit-id.

Commit-id is very useful when rolling back the version. , it is equivalent to a snapshot, which can be returned to here at any time in the future through the combined command with git reset.

1、git commit -m 'message'

## The #-m parameter means that you can directly enter the following "message". If you do not add the -m parameter, you cannot directly enter the message. Instead, an editor, usually vim, will be called to let you enter the message.

message is the statement we use to briefly describe this submission.

2,

git commit -am 'message' -am is equivalent to -a -m

-a parameter can modify or delete the execution in all tracked files The operated files are submitted to the local warehouse, even if they have not been added to the staging area through git add.

Note: Newly added files (that is, files that are not managed by the git system) cannot be submitted to the local warehouse. of.

<span style="font-size: 18px;">Git push<strong></strong></span>

Use the

git commit command to commit the modifications from the staging area After arriving at the local repository, only the last step is left to push the branch of the local repository to the corresponding branch on the remote server. git push is git push , for examplegit push origin master: refs/for/master, which is to push the local master branch to the corresponding master branch on the remote host origin, where origin is the name of the remote host. The first master is the local branch name, and the second master is the remote branch name.

1,

git push origin master

If the remote branch is omitted, as above, it means pushing the local branch to the remote branch with which there is a tracking relationship (usually both same name), if the remote branch does not exist, it will be created

2,

git push origin: refs/for/master

If the local branch name is omitted, then Indicates deleting the specified remote branch, because this is equivalent to pushing an empty local branch to the remote branch, which is equivalent to git push origin –delete master

3,

git push origin

If there is a tracking relationship between the current branch and the remote branch, both the local branch and the remote branch can be omitted, and the current branch will be pushed to the corresponding branch of the origin host

4,

git push

If the current branch has only one remote branch, the host name can be omitted, such as git push. You can use git branch -r to view the remote branch name
